Etihad ESCO signs agreement to retrofit Dubai Maritime City’s facilities

UAE - Mubasher: Etihad Energy Services Company (Etihad ESCO), a subsidiary of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A), has entered into an agreement to retrofit buildings at the facilities of Dubai Maritime City (DMC), DP World's purpose-built maritime centre.

Under the agreement, modern air conditioning, lighting, and thermal insulation solutions will be installed at the DMC's facilities, in addition to the installation of three cooling systems, according to a press release on Tuesday.

Meanwhile, the air exchange unit control system will be modified by installing smart valves and replacing the triple valves with dual ones and a number of air conditioning units with modern energy-saving units.

The project is expected to save 729,373 kilowatt-hours annually, representing 20% of the total consumption at the DMC facilities.

Commenting on the agreement, the CEO and Managing Director of DP World, UAE Region, Mohammed Al Muallem, said: "We are certain that the implementation of practices that comply with the Green Building programme by the Government of Dubai, will help us save costs, showcasing our concern for the greater good of the environment and strengthening our contribution to the Emirates Green Agenda 2030."
